I always enjoy trying new decoy spreads and was wondering what were some that yall enjoy using and are most effective whether it be on a tank, big water, or flooded field, what's your fav?

How many decoys, what type (mallard, gadwall, etc.), location, and layout of spread.

Just trying to get some new ideas for next yr.

OK here we go back on track.... @ the Barney about a dozen dekes with a little of everything I've got in it....no more than 3 or 4 of any species. Mix them randomly in about a 20 foot diameter group. I learned this from watching them feed and rest.....
They will try to invite themselves to breakfast or some rest with their friends by landing on the back of it......
